Why Hydraulics Over Cable?
Hydraulic handbrakes offer:
Consistent feel even under repeated use.
Immediate rear wheel lock-up for drift entry and tight rally manoeuvres.
Greater reliability with less wear than traditional cable systems.
For competitive motorsport, a hydraulic system isn’t just an upgrade—it’s essential.
How Do We Compare to the Competition?
The motorsport market offers a wide range of hydraulic handbrakes, from entry-level to premium:
Motamec Alloy Hand Brake – Adjustable CNC handle, sold without master cylinder, from ~£107.
Redspec Vertical Hydraulic Handbrake – Budget aluminium frame/steel lever, ~£70, master cylinder extra.
OBP & Compbrake Hydraulic Handbrakes – Steel construction with optional billet versions, ~£117–£157 (master cylinder often sold separately).
Kit WRC Carbon Fibre Handbrake – High-end carbon-fibre build, ~£385, master cylinder not included.
